To understand the importance of these galleries, one must first understand the nature of wrestling photography. Wrestling is notoriously difficult to shoot. It takes place on a mat, often in poorly lit high school gyms, and features athletes moving at explosive speeds in three dimensions. A photographer must anticipate a takedown, a throw, or a reversal before it happens, often ending up with just a fraction of a second to capture the peak of the action. SmugMug became the de facto home for these specialized photographers because of its robust infrastructure. It allows creators to upload massive, high-resolution files without compression, ensuring that the sweat, the strain of a neck bridging against the mat, and the intensity in an athlete's eyes are preserved in crystal clarity.

A single tournament might have dozens of weight classes, schools, and brackets. SmugMug allows you to build multi-layered galleries so users can find their specific wrestler in seconds.
SmugMug integrates directly with world-class print labs like Bay Photo, WHCC, and Loxley Colour. When a parent buys a 5x7 print or a custom memory mate collage from a wrestling gallery, SmugMug handles the payment processing, sends the order to the lab, and ships the final product directly to the customer's door. The photographer simply sets their price margins and collects the profit. Digital Downloads and Social Sharing Licenses
